Wiandre Pretorius implicated in the Madlanga Commission survives attempted hit in Boksburg

  • Wiandre Pretorius, implicated in the Madlanga Commission, survived an alleged attempted hit in Boksburg on Thursday morning.
  • Pretorius was previously named by Witness D, Marius van der Merwe, who was assassinated last year after testifying at the commission.
  • Commission officials say security measures are in place as police investigate the incident.

There has been an attempted hit in Boksburg on one of the law enforcement officers implicated in the Madlanga Commission of Inquiry.

The alleged hit on Wiandre Pretorius by three gunmen occurred in Boksburg on Thursday morning.

Pretorius, who survived the hit, was named by Witness D, Marius van der Merwe, during his testimony at the Madlanga Commission.

Marius van der Merwe, better known as Witness D, was assassinated last year outside his Brakpan home following a chilling testimony at the commission.

Gauteng Provincial Commissioner Lieutenant General Mthombeni is on his way to the scene of the alleged attempted hit.

Madlanga Commission of Inquiry spokesperson Jeremy Michaels said that after the assassination of Van der Merwe, the commission met with relevant law enforcement agencies and took all necessary measures to ensure the safety and security of both witnesses and commission staff.

“We are aware that Mr Pretorius has been in contact with other law enforcement agencies. I don’t want to get into the details of that. I can’t at this point. But of course, we are concerned for the lives of any people who may have information that is relevant to the commission,” Michaels said.
